iPhone has introduced a new member to its lineup (2022). The new iPhone SE is a budget-friendly model for 2020, and it will be introduced on March 18th, with preorders starting on March 11th.

This new iPhone SE completes Apple’s entry-level lineup, costing $429 (up to $30) and featuring the newest A15 Bionic CPU, 5G capability, a slightly bigger battery, and more robust front and back glass.

Even though it has a dated design with a smaller 4.7-inch screen and large bezels, the 2022 iPhone SE has a lot to admire — especially if you adore a Touch ID fingerprint sensor and home button.

The new iPhone SE looks just like the iPhone SE from 2020, which looked a lot like the iPhone 8 from 2017.

This new iPhone SE has a 4.7-inch Retina LCD display with 1334 x 750 resolution, thick bezels, and a glass back that permits Qi-compatible wireless charging. It’s also available in three colors (midnight, starlight, and red).

Apple managed to cram a larger battery, a 5G sub-6GHz modem, and tougher glass coatings inside the iPhone 13 variants, in addition to sharing the same A15 Bionic CPU.

The SE’s front and back glass are claimed to equal the iPhone 13’s back glass, so while it’s not Ceramic Shield for improved drop protection, it’s a step in the right direction.

according to Apple. It’s the hardest glass in a smartphone on the front and back, Although the 2022 iPhone SE is more durable, it only maintains the previous model’s IP67 water and dust protection.

Camera hardware is another remnant of the 2020 SE. The lenses and sensors are identical, however, the A15 allows a newer software generation of computational photography with Smart HDR 4 thanks to its inclusion.
